From Traditional to Digital: The Shift in Memory Training Tools

Historically, memory games relied on physical cards and tabletop exercises, often limited by location and accessibility. However, digital transformation has revolutionized this landscape by introducing interactive, adaptive, and easily distributable formats. Mobile platforms, in particular, have become instrumental in democratizing mental training, offering users the ability to engage with cognitive exercises anywhere and anytime.

Design Principles for Effective Mobile Memory Games

Creating compelling mobile memory games requires a nuanced understanding of cognitive load, user interface design, and accessibility considerations. Successful platforms incorporate:

  • engaging visual cues to facilitate quick recognition
  • adaptive difficulty scaling to match user progression
  • intuitive navigation to minimize learning curves
  • multimodal feedback through sounds and haptics for multisensory engagement

Innovation Spotlight: Unlocking Accessibility with Browser-Based Gaming

While many cognitive training apps are confined within dedicated ecosystems or specific operating systems, browser-based games extend reach and inclusivity. They eliminate barriers such as device compatibility issues and installation hurdles, making mental exercises more accessible to diverse populations.
